How is Orencia dosed for adult rheumatoid arthritis?

Orencia (abatacept) is given by intravenous infusion or subcutaneous injection for adult rheumatoid arthritis.

How does the intravenous dosing schedule work?

The IV dose is based on body weight: 500 mg for patients under 60 kg, 750 mg for 60-100 kg, and 1,000 mg for patients above 100 kg. The first three infusions occur at weeks 0, 2, and 4, then every four weeks afterward.

What is the subcutaneous dosing option?

After an optional single IV loading dose, patients can receive 125 mg subcutaneous injection weekly. No dose adjustment is needed for patients who already completed an IV series.
